I swapped out my crappy OEM [read: broken] endlinks for the awesome bomb diggity perrin ones. Yes they finally came! Perrin sent a new set. My sway bar had initially been installed improperly I found out by comparing the perrin photo instructions. I think that this might actually be a product of the OEM vs. Perrin endlinks, and not really an installation issue-- although SOG did tell me that it was wrong before. The suspension is a bit different from the WRX and it goes above the bars from the dif, instead of under them. It was basically put in like for a wrx, not for the sti. An easy mistake to make, although I do think it's the endlink type difference. I looked under John's car [Silent23] and it was totally different under there. Crazy. The endlink swap ended up taking longer than expected because I had to remove the charcoal box and bushings and reposition the swaybar over the dif bars [ok I don't know what these are really called, sorry! but they are like rods that go to the dif or something].

Anyhow here's photos. I love the snapped OEM one. That is out of control. My car doesn't make that awful clunk anymore [if you've been in my car you know the sound], and rides better. I stiffened up the rear bar to medium [24mm] as well, so now I run 27mm up front and 24mm in the back. At dday3 I'm going to put the rear all the way to 26mm and see how that goes.
